Mrs. Raffaela (Serra)
Battino, 79, of 2425 Cudaback
Ave., died Monday (May 8,
1972) at Memorial Medical
Center.
, She was born in Foggia,
Italy, Nov. 4,1893, and came to
Niagara Falls in 1914.
She was a member of the
Golden Agers Club.
Survivors include her
husband, Frank Battino; four
sons, Albert and Louis Battino
of Niagara Falls, Gabriel
Battino of Ontario, Calif., and
Julien Battino of Flint, Mich.;
four daughers, Mrs. Peter
(Carmela) Cerra, Mrs. Joseph
(Louise) Famiglietti, Mrs.
Paul (Mary) Inguaggiato and
Mrs. James (Ida) Engle, all of
Niagara Falls; one sister in
Florida; thee brothers, Ciro
Calabrese of Niagara Falls,
and two in Italy; 20 grandchildren,
10 great-grandchildren
and several nieces
and nephews.

Niagara Gazette - 3/21/1961
GOLDEN WEDDING ANNIVERSARY-Mr. and Mrs.
Frank Battino, Cudaback Avenue, celebraled
their 50th wedding anniversary at a dinner party
at the Como Restaurant Saturday. Mr. and Mrs.
Battino were married in Lucera, Italy, on March
21, 1911, and have resided in Niagara Falls since
1913. They have eight children and 20 grandchildren.
